Key findings: P6410 - Tourist accommodation, February 2023

Measured in nominal terms (current prices), total income for the tourist accommodation industry increased by 34,8% in February 2023 compared with February 2022.

Income from accommodation increased by 59,4% year-on-year in February 2023, the result of a 12,0% increase in the number of stay unit nights sold and a 42,3% increase in the average income per stay unit night sold.

In February 2023, the largest contributors to the 59,4% year-on-year increase in income from accommodation were:

  •  hotels (69,1% and contributing 35,0 percentage points); and
  •   ‘other’ accommodation (55,9% and contributing 22,0 percentage points).
Income from accommodation increased by 51,6% in the three months ended February 2023 compared with the three months ended February 2022. The main contributors to this increase were:

  • hotels (65,1% and contributing 30,9 percentage points); and
  •   ‘other’ accommodation (44,5% and contributing 18,8 percentage points).

Seasonally adjusted income from accommodation increased by 2,7% month-on-month in February 2023 following a decrease of 0,3% month-on-month in January 2023.
